Web1 dec. 2024 · In 2024 it was estimated that there were 106,890 people living with HIV in the UK. This is just under 2 in every 1000 people. There isn’t UK-wide data available for 2024 yet. Around 92% of the people accessing HIV care in the UK live in England and of those, 41% live in London. How many people are diagnosed with HIV each year? WebThere are currently 944,000 people with dementia in the UK, more than ever before, and this number is projected to increase. Due to the gradual nature of dementia, the mild early-stage symptoms and the low diagnosis rate, it is difficult to know the exact number of people living with the condition.
